R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Respond to calls for assistance
  • Administer first aid and level-appropriate care per state, local and national guidelines
  • Properly assess injuries and the coordination for appropriate transportation to medical facilities
  • Effectively communication with Safety Managers, EMS Personnel and Medical Facility Staff
  • Assist site Safety Personnel with safety related duties and inspections
  • Provide detailed documentation of medical and safety related incidents
  • Coordinate with Safety Managers in maintaining the most safe and secure construction site environment
  • Administer daily site required drug and alcohol testing programs

BASIC QUALIFICATIONS
  • High school diploma or GED equivalent
  • Current CPR or BLS (Basic Life Support) or equivalent credential
  • State Certification for EMT or Paramedic or National EMT certification, (NREMT)
  • At least 2 years of experience working as an EMT
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S
  • Prior experience with Site Safety
  • Safety certifications like
  • CHST, Construction Health and Safety Technician
  • CSP, Certified Safety Professional
  • OSHA 30
  • Construction industry experience
  • Excellent customer service skills
  • Excellent communication skills
